China Action Hurts Galvanizers in Tianjin and Hebei

Galvanizers in North China were greatly impacted by environmental protection inspections from April 20.

Central Environmental Protection Team ordered all acid-related producers in Jinghai District, Tianjin cease production from May 1. Most local galvanizers were forced to shut down.

China closed all galvanizers in Bazhou City, Hebei Province for environmental protection assessment from April 20, SMM reported. The environmental protection assessment will last for one month, majorly covering galvanized tube/pipe and galvanized sheet plants. About 10,000 tonnes per month of local zinc consumption will be affected.

Environmental protection drive in the two regions will affect about 50,000 tonnes of zinc utilization per month, SMM said.

SMM understands production at some galvanizers in Jinghai District had been restricted in mid-April. Daqiu Village was significantly affected. All acid-related producers in Jinghai District, Tianjin were required to cease production in May. Impact from this round of environmental protection will last until after the Belt & Road Forum. Those that met environmental protection requirements will be re-checked, restricting their output. About 200 local galvanizing lines will be affected, whose monthly zinc consumption total 40,000-50,000 tonnes per month.

When they will restart is still indeterminate. Handan and Cangzhou have yet to be affected.

Some galvanizers have passed environmental protection inspections, but will also be affected since all acid-related plants are forced to shut down, SMM said. Besides, pickled coils supply in Beijing, Tianjin and Hebei was limited. This, combined with restrictions on sulfuric acid transportation, will further disrupt galvanizing.

[Penoles Releases Q1 2026 Production Report] Penoles released its Q1 2026 production data. For the zinc mine segment, its zinc concentrates production reached 66,600 mt in the quarter, up 15.6% YoY, mainly driven by the resumption of operations at Tizapa and improved grades and recovery rates at Juanicipio, Sabinas, and Fresnillo. For the zinc smelting segment, its zinc production reached 48,100 mt in the quarter, up 14.7% YoY, primarily due to an increase in the volume of concentrates processed by the zinc smelter, which had undergone its annual planned maintenance shutdown in Q1 2025.

[Kaz Mineral Disclosed Q1 2026 Production]Recently, Kaz Mineral disclosed its Q1 2026 production.Zinc in concentrate output of 10.4 kt was lower quarter-on-quarter, primarily reflecting reduced processing volumes at the East Region following planned maintenance at the Nikolayevsky concentrator in January.

[Zinc Concentrates Production Information] Gold Resource disclosed its Q1 2026 production. Its zinc metal content production was 1,143 mt during the quarter. Total ore processed during the quarter was 74,444 mt, an increase of 31% compared to the same period in 2025. Gold and silver production increased by 126% and 54%, respectively. Copper, lead, and zinc production also increased by 39%, 36%, and 64%, respectively.
